Web paedophile jailed for attack on girl aged 11

A 24-YEAR-OLD man who befriended a young girl on the internet and went on to sexually assault her has been jailed.

Scott Spencer used Facebook to contact the 11-year-old girl and arranged to meet up with her in Long Eaton, in April.

Spencer, of Ilkeston Road, Nottingham, went to a number of shops with the girl and then took her to an area off the canal bank where he kissed and sexually assaulted her.

At Derby Crown Court, Spencer admitted sexual assault of a female under 13 and two counts of inciting the girl to engage in sexual activity.

He was sentenced to four years in prison.

He was also ordered to remain on the sex offenders’ register for life, given a sexual offences prevention order for a period of 20 years and disqualified from working with children.

He denied a charge of witness intimidation and this was left on the file.
